1. Disconnect the brake pedal pushrod (1) from the brake pedal.

2. Inspect the brake pedal pushrod eyelet bushing (2), if equipped, for cracks and/or excessive

wear.

3. Reposition the pedal pushrod boot (3) toward the front of the vehicle to expose as much of

the pedal pushrod (1) as possible.

4. Inspect the brake pedal pushrod (1) for straightness.

5. If the brake pedal pushrod eyelet bushing (2) exhibited cracks and/or excessive wear, then

the bushing requires replacement.

6. If the brake pedal pushrod (1) is not straight, then the pushrod requires replacement.

7. Return the pedal pushrod boot (3) to its original position on the pedal pushrod (1).

8. Connect the brake pedal pushrod (1) to the brake pedal.

MASTER CYLINDER RESERVOIR FILLING

1. Visually inspect the brake fluid level through the brake master cylinder reservoir.

2. If the brake fluid level is at or below the half-full point during routine fluid checks, the

brake system should be inspected for wear and possible brake fluid leaks.

3. If the brake fluid level is at or below the half-full point during routine fluid checks, and an

inspection of the brake system did not reveal wear or brake fluid leaks, the brake fluid may
be topped-off up to the maximum-fill level.

4. If brake system service was just completed, the brake fluid may be topped-off up to the

maximum-fill level.

5. If the brake fluid level is above the half-full point, adding brake fluid is not recommended

under normal conditions.

6. If brake fluid is to be added to the master cylinder reservoir, clean the outside of the

reservoir on and around the reservoir cap prior to removing the cap and diaphragm. Use
only Delco Supreme 11®, GM P/N 12377967 (Canadian P/N 992667), or equivalent DOT-
3 brake fluid from a clean, sealed brake fluid container.

NOTE:

When adding fluid to the brake master cylinder reservoir, use only
Delco Supreme 11®, GM P/N 12377967 (Canadian P/N 992667), or
equivalent DOT-3 brake fluid from a clean, sealed brake fluid
container. The use of any type of fluid other than the recommended
type of brake fluid, may cause contamination which could result in
damage to the internal rubber seals and/or rubber linings of
hydraulic brake system components.
